Jason Statham Is Back ~ The Beekeeper

February 01, 2024 18:25 - 6 minutes - 6.21 MB

I was so happy to see Jason Statham back in a big budget action movie. The beekeeper is right out of the John Wick mold, but with a better story, at least a better story than the third and fourth installments of the John Wick series. Jeremy Irons plays the inimitable, aristocratic monster as only he can. Great cinematography great editing, and clearly room for a second installment.

1971—The Year That Music Changed Everything on Apple TV

January 24, 2024 20:35 - 6 minutes - 7.1 MB

"1971—The Year That Music Changed Everything on Apple TV" is an amazing eight-part documentary series on Apple TV, chronicling the end, or the collapse, if you will, of the Sixties and the birth of the Seventies. Culture, politics, and the music of Marvin Gaye, James Brown, Sly Stone, The Rolliing Stones, Carole King, Joni Mitchell, John Lennon, Lou Reed, David Bowie, Marc Bolan, Alice Cooper, Tina Turner, the list goes on.
